Social care partnership nominated for top award

    Photo Credit - WYHHCP

    West Yorkshire and Harrogate Health and Care Partnership has been shortlisted for a prestigious Health Service Journal (HSJ) award in the System Led Support for Carers category.

    The Partnership is formed from the NHS, councils, independent care providers, Healthwatch and hundreds of carer and community organisations. It says it is working together across the region to further support 260,000 unpaid carers, including young people who care for parents and siblings.

    Category winners for the awards will be announced on the 21 November in London.

    Fatima Shah-Khan, Partnership lead for unpaid carers said: “We want West Yorkshire and Harrogate to be a place where carers are identified, valued and supported so that all carers no matter how old or where they live receive the same level of care and attention. We have a great opportunity to work together and raise the profile of the care delivered by unpaid carers. We’re delighted to have been short listed for this award especially as we are at the start of our work and there is still much to do”.
